> +@item -autorotate
> +Automatically rotate the video according to file metadata. Enabled by
> +default, use @option{-noautorotate} to disable it.
> +
> +@item -autoscale
> +Automatically scale the video according to the resolution of first frame.
> +Enabled by default, use @option{-noautoscale} to disable it.
> +
>  @item -noautorotate
>  Disable automatically rotating video based on file metadata.
>
> +@item -noautoscale
> +Disable automatically scale video based on first frame resolution.

Istn't there a "-no" option for most (all?) ffmpeg options but we only
document one of them?
I believe "autorotate" and "autoscale" are sufficient if there counterparts
are also described.
